On May 3, 2018, Radware’s malware protection service detected a zero-day malware threat at one of its customers, a global manufacturing firm, by using machine-learning algorithms. This malware campaign is propagating via socially-engineered links on Facebook and is infecting users by abusing a Google Chrome extension The post Nigelthorn Malware Abuses Chrome Extensions to Cryptomine and Steal Data appeared first on Radware Blog.
